I've been looking over the current test scenarios on the TINKERPOP-1784
branch, with the C# GLV test suite in mind, and oh man that's an impressive
amount of scenarios!

So far, I have a suggestion.

Instead of

  Scenario: g_V_fold_countXlocalX
    Given the modern graph
    And the traversal of
      """
      g.V().fold().count(Scope.local)
      """

We could use

  Scenario: g_V_fold_countXlocalX
    Given the modern graph
    And parameter 1 being an enum
      """
      Scope.local
      """
    And the traversal of
      """
      g.V().fold().count(param1)
      """

That way we can exclude enums from possible parameter values, narrowing
down the amount of types of parameters allowed, ie: const numeric, const
strings (wrapped in double quotes), traversals (starting with `__`) , ...,
making parsing the traversal a little easier.
